US mercenary says he planned to abduct Venezuelan president

A US mercenary has been detained in Venezuela after allegedly being ordered to abduct the country’s president Nicolás Maduro.
Venezuelan state media is broadcasting footage showing the former Special Forces soldier admitting his part in a botched bid to oust Venezuela’s president.
The US Secretary of State Mike Pompeo denies Washington knew of the attack insisting that, if they had, "it would have gone differently".
